I do agree with Stangs Bane though, I didn't even think about the spool, you will definitely want to get a trutrac, I have one in my 9" and its great. I would also suggest getting factory gears, and not race gears because the race gears WHINE and its LOUD. The race gears are a really hardened gear and they transmit noise like a mofo.

And the guys in Australia that told you that you should have made 650 RWHP, they're correct. They've been doing this for 5 years now, they past the 600 RWHP mark 5 years ago with nice tunes and nice idles. The ITB's are the key to the power.
But you do know there's something really wrong with your 427ci. That Harrop, when tuned properly and improperly can have huge hp ranges. Not saying that's what was up with yours, just saying.
My 427ci is 7 years old, uses a ported LS6 intake, ported LS6 heads and a stock ported TB. 11.3:1 cr and an auto tranny 4L60E. Cam is only 244/244 .610/.610 114 lsa.
I make 490 RWHP with no cats through a full exhuast. Idles like a baby.
Made 487 RWHP on a different dyno about 1 year later.
On the other hand, I know at least 10 guys with C6 Z06's (427ci) who are in the 580-610 RWHP range after head porting, cam upgrades, exhaust upgrades and a tune. M6 of course. The guys who made upowards of 610 RWHP have pretty nice cams, but definitely not as big as yours was. If these guys throw a Harrop on there with a good tune they will make another 60 RWHP. E85 and bump up the compression, and there's more power. Put a huge cam in also like you and the 454ci guy has, more power, and on top of that the 454ci guy has 27 more cubes, when in a properly built engine is good for another 32 hp right there. That does all equal up to right about 750 RWHP.
Plus, he has a mid engine set-up and that tranny he's using has minimal drivetrain loss.
